site stats

Mybatis if test 字符串包含

WebOct 29, 2024 · parameterType:传给此语句的参数的全路径名或别名 例:com.test.poso.User或user; resultType :语句返回值类型或别名。 注意,如果是集合,那么这里填写的是集合的泛型,而不是集合本身(resultType 与resultMap 不能并用) ... Mybatis系列全解(八):Mybatis的9大动态SQL标签你知道 ... WebJul 30, 2024 · 正确写法:. . 或者:. 注意:1 旁边是双引号. 因为mybatis会把'1'解析为字符,java是强类型语言,所以不能这样写,需要双引号. 扩展一下,我们有时候项目里面 ...

mybatis if test

WebJun 24, 2015 · 记录使用 mybatis 遇到的 问题 (1) - 关于if 标签判断问题. 记录使用 mybatis 遇到的 问题 关于 mybatis if 标签 的 判断 问题 如果mapper层入参类型是int或integer类型 不可做 test="number != ''", 判断, 如果业务需求有为0, 条件则不满足 解决方法 判断 test="number != null" 即可解决 ... WebJun 18, 2024 · 可以直接使用 contains判断 medisure pregnancy tests https://simul-fortes.com

mybatis快速入门案例02:使用mapper映射 - 知乎 - 知乎专栏

WebMar 9, 2024 · mybatis的xml中if判断的test条件为字符串中包含另一个字符串. 直接使用 contains 进行判断. Web当我们使用MyBatis的时候,需要在mapper.xml中书写大量的SQL语句。当我们使用MyBatis Generator(MBG)作为代码生成器时,也会生成大量的mapper.xml文件。其实从MBG 1.3.6版本以后,MyBatis官方已经推荐使用Dynamic SQ… naichoplaw

mybatis if标签判断的问题-CSDN社区

Category:MyBatis if tag: conditional judgment - programming.vip

Tags:Mybatis if test 字符串包含

Mybatis if test 字符串包含

mybatis 怎么判断list集合是否包含指定数据 - 开发技术 - 亿速云

WebMar 27, 2024 · Mybatis if test 문자열처리 동적쿼리(dynamic sql)에서 많이 사용되는 Mybatis if test 에서의 문자열 처리. ※ java 문법과 동일하다고 보면 된다. 즉 문자열 비교를 위해 연산자 사용을 해선 안되고 equals 함수 사용시 null 값이 파라미터로 들어올 가능성을 대비하여 코딩해야 한다. [Mybatis if test 에서의 문자열 ... WebApr 10, 2024 · 聊一聊Mybatis插件机制,你有没有自己编写 Mybatis 插件去实现一些自定义需求呢? 插件是一种常见的扩展方式,大多数开源框架也都支持用户通过添加自定义插件的方式来扩展或改变框架原有的功能。

Mybatis if test 字符串包含

Did you know?

Web概述. 在案例01中,我们手动创建了UserImpl,实际上这个步骤是可以省略的,我们可以使用mybatis自动映射帮我们自动创建UserImpl。. 在这种使用场景中,我们只需要关心UserDao有哪些接口,以及UserMapper.xml中如何实现即可,至于UserDaoImpl,mybatis会自动帮我们 … WebMar 21, 2024 · 日拱一卒:MyBatis 动态 SQL 1. OGNL表达式. if; choose (when, otherwise) trim (where, set) foreach; 1.1 标签 元素只在子元素有内容的情况下才插入 WHERE子句;而且,若子句的开头为 AND 或OR, 元素也会将它们去除

Web在mysql中可以使用字符串函数“find_in_set()”来判断字段是否包含某个字符串,该函数的语法是“SELECT * FROM users WHERE find_in_set('字符', 字段名);”。 Webmybatis 的if 比较标签在比较数值时可以这样写: 在比较字符串时可以这么写: 记得是外面是单引号,里面是双引号。 同 …

WebAug 5, 2024 · mybatis坑之数字字符串比对原. 在运行时发现不管tagType传什么值都不会进入两个if中, 经过分析,'1'是会被转成数字,所以这里有两种方案: 方案1:将参数转为int类型,再进行比较. 一笠风雨任生平. WebJul 26, 2024 · MyBatisで条件分岐を実装する。ifで条件分岐。MyBatisでは「if test」で「もし~だったら」という条件を書くことができます。chooseで条件分岐。MyBatisで「if-else if-else」のような条件分岐を作成するときは「choose-when-otherwise」を使用します。

WebMar 23, 2024 · 玩转Mybatis高级特性:让你的数据操作更上一层楼. [toc] Mybatis高级特性能够帮助我们更加灵活地操作数据库,包括动态SQL、缓存机制、插件机制、自定义类型转换等。. 学习这些特性可以让我们更好地利用Mybatis,提高数据操作的效率和质量。. 未来的道路 …

WebMar 13, 2024 · 在 MyBatis 的 mapper.xml 中,如果要对 if 标签的 test 属性进行取反,可以使用 `not` 关键字。 具体的使用方法为:在 if 标签的 test 属性值前面加上 `not` 关键字即可,例如: ``` ... ``` 这样,当 `condition` 的值为 true 时,if 标签内部的语句将不会执行;而当 `condition` 的值为 false 时 ... nai chinese characterWebMybatis-plus概述. MyBatis-Plus(简称 MP)是一个 MyBatis的增强工具,在 MyBatis 的基础上只做增强不做改变,为简化开发、提高效率而生。 mediswitch onlinehttp://www.mybatis.cn/archives/47.html mediswitch medical aid